Andrey N. Chernikov is a scholar working on Computer Graphics and Computer-Aided Design, Computer Vision and Pattern Recognition and Computational Mechanics. According to data from OpenAlex, Andrey N. Chernikov has authored 41 papers receiving a total of 445 indexed citations (citations by other indexed papers that have themselves been cited), including 32 papers in Computer Graphics and Computer-Aided Design, 14 papers in Computer Vision and Pattern Recognition and 12 papers in Computational Mechanics. Recurrent topics in Andrey N. Chernikov's work include Computational Geometry and Mesh Generation (32 papers), Computer Graphics and Visualization Techniques (21 papers) and Robotic Path Planning Algorithms (9 papers). Andrey N. Chernikov is often cited by papers focused on Computational Geometry and Mesh Generation (32 papers), Computer Graphics and Visualization Techniques (21 papers) and Robotic Path Planning Algorithms (9 papers). Andrey N. Chernikov collaborates with scholars based in United States, Ghana and Greece. Andrey N. Chernikov's co-authors include Nikos Chrisochoides, Kevin Barker, Keshav Pingali, Filip Blagojević, Christos D. Antonopoulos, Dimitrios S. Nikolopoulos, Kazuhiro Nakahashi, Alan M. Shih, Bharat K. Soni and Yasushi Ito and has published in prestigious journals such as BMC Bioinformatics, SIAM Journal on Scientific Computing and IEEE Transactions on Parallel and Distributed Systems.
